Post Office

There are no mail boxes at Fire Island National Seashore facilities. Seasonal post offices are located at some neighboring communities on Fire Island. Post Offices are also located at gateway communities of Bay Shore, Sayville, Patchogue and Mastic Beach.

Portrait of William Floyd, painted in 1792, with his Mastic plantation in background.

In 1790, William Floyd - one of New York's four signers of the Declaration of Independence - was the largest slave holder in Suffolk County, New York, at one time. The 1790 U. S. Census indicates that 14 slaves lived on his Mastic plantation. More...
